Spicy Shrimp and Rice

Weight Watchers recipe. 4 pts per serving (1-1/2 cups shrimp mixture w/ 3/4 cups rice)

Ingredients

  • 1 C long-grain white rice
  • 1 medium onion, chopped
  • 1 green b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 red bell pepper, chopped
  • 6 garlic cloves, chopped
  • 1-1/2 C strained tomatoes (or if you can't find that, use regular canned tomato puree -- that's what I've been using)
  • 1 tsp Cajun seasoning
  • 1/4 tsp red pepper flakes
  • 3/4 lb medium sh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 tsp grated lemon zest

Details

Servings 4

Preparation

Step 1

1. Cook the rice according to the package directions; keep warm.

2. Meanwhile, spray a large nonstick skillet with olive oil nonstick spray and stet over medium-high heat. Add the onion and peppers and cook, stirring often, until softened, 5 minutes.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 30 seconds.

3. Add the tomatoes, seasoning, pepper flakes and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at and simmer, stirring occasionally, until thickened, about 5 minutes. Stir in the shrimp and simmer until just opaque in the center, about 5 minutes longer. Stir in the lemon zest. Serve with the rice.
